About Pålsboda

Pålsboda is a locality situated in Hallsberg Municipality, Örebro County, Sweden with 1,552 inhabitants in 2010.

About Pålsboda

Pålsboda is a small town in Sweden (Örebro) with a population of 1,610. The city sits at an elevation of 308 feet (94 meters) above sea level. The average annual temperature is 43°F (6°C). Temperatures range from 26°F in January to 61°F in July. Annual precipitation averages 25.7 inches. The timezone is Europe/Stockholm.

The median household income in Pålsboda is $43,308, which is 42% below the national average of $75,149. The area has 177 business establishments.
